The Pressbooks-Learning Locker Integration is currently experiencing partial degradation.

UPDATE (11/24): After deployment of a number of hotfixes and testing, the issue with the Pressbooks - Learning Locker integration appears to be resolved.

UPDATE (11/5): Members of Learn@UW-Madison, TRAD, Learning Pool and Pressbooks are still working to resolve the issue. We have a few solutions in mind, but those solutions need to be tested before they are deployed to our production instance of Pressbooks. We estimate the fix will be in place within the next week.

Some features of the Pressbooks-Learning Locker integration are currently not working as normal. Specifically, grade-passback and the instructor view of student activity features are currently down. Learning Analytic data is still being sent to (and ingested by) Learning Locker from Pressbooks, but the display of that data in Pressbooks and the ability to push that data to the Canvas Gradebook is currently not working.

It is possible that some other plugins in Pressbooks may have to be temporarily disabled in order to resolve the issue. Specifically, the plugin allowing for H5P to be embedded in the Hypothes.is annotation layer. This news item will be updated to reflect these changes (if they are necessary).

Learn@UW-Madison is working with collaborators in TRAD and Learning Pool (the vendor for Learning Locker) to resolve the issue.
